***UPDATE***
Mickey Rats Beach Club is still up for sale. The owner says the Paladino contract expired, according to The Buffalo News.

Long-time owner Richi Alberts said that the contract with Paladino and four other investors expired in early September after 90 days and was no longer valid. As a result, he said, it’s business as usual right now as the summer season comes to an end.

“I’m having a seasonal closing party this Saturday, as I usually do,” he said, adding that he currently plans to reopen next year, although it’s still for sale.

ORIGINAL POST:

It's one of our favorite places to be in the summer.  According to The Buffalo News, Mickey Rats Beach Club is being sold to The Paladino Firm.

Rumors of a sell have been swirling for weeks around the popular summer hangout, but The Buffalo News confirmed it today:

William Paladino, CEO of Ellicott Development Co., on Wednesday confirmed rumors that the Evans club and its Captain Kidds Restaurant are under contract to be acquired by the Buffalo developer.

Will they turn it into an upscale restaurant?  Apartments?  There is no clear cut plan at this point as they say they're still considering the options with the property.
